The Never Ending Quest - Episode 115750

What Angela experienced on hearing this could best be described as blank shock. She blinked twice, and finally said, "What?"

"You heard me," he said, standing up. "Quickly, we must go!"

He spoke urgently, almost frantically, but she didn't budge an inch. "What did you call me?"

"Fred! I called you Fred, yes, I know who you really are, and I'll explain how if you come with me!"

"I can't walk out without telling Mel and Joe," she said, confused. "We haven't even paid yet."

"Oh for the love of--" and he leaned forward and placed a hand against her forehead, quickly mumbling a few words she didn't understand. She felt some switch flipping in her head, but didn't know what until he said, "Now, get up, and come with me" and her body automatically complied.

He pulled her along by the hand straight out the front door, launching right into it: "My true name is Belboz, and I am an Allarian sorcerer. It is your destiny to defeat the dragon but some force has trapped you in this body and this world. Yesterday I came through a portal that had just opened to connect this world to our own, and it should still be there, but if we miss it, the next one won't appear at least for several months, and time is of the essence. People are dying every day at the claws of the dragon. You must fulfill your destiny."

Angela's head was spinning. "There's... there's a way to go back?" she asked faintly.

"Portals between worlds open and close naturally. There are patterns, studied by advanced sorcerers. It was sheer luck that one was about to open when I found out you had been taken. So I traveled to the site, hopped through, and magicked your friend to fall in love with me so I could meet you and make sure it was really you. Now, my powers are much more limited in this world, but--"

At this Angela would have stopped in her tracks, but her feet were still moving against her will. "You cast a love spell on Mel?" she cried in outrage.

They had reached Bel's car now, and he pushed her into the shotgun seat and got into the driver's seat himself. Starting the engine, he said, "Yeah?"

"How could you?" she demanded, itching to slap him.

He glanced over at her. "Why do you care, Lord Fred?"

"It's Angela," she said coldly. "And you manipulated my best friend for your own selfish needs--"

"Selfish?" Belboz exclaimed, flabbergasted. "Fred, the lives of everyone in our realm are at stake!"

"Your realm, you mean."

By now it was clear to the sorcerer that beyond having been changed in body and given an additional set of memories, something else had been done to Fred. Though he was running low on magical energy, he waved a hand, putting Fred into a deep sleep, and started driving towards the site of the portal as fast as he could.

Half an hour later he arrived at the campsite, and took up the small woman into his arms to go the rest of the way on foot. The portal had opened in the middle of the woods. He arrived at the site after another forty-five minutes of hiking, and his arms, by this time, were exhausted.
